    “Radiografía” del estado de la reutilización de software en Colombia

    Due to competitive markets, the software business wants faster, better, and cheaper solutions in a short amount of time. Software reuse emerges as a viable solution to these demands since it offers significant benefits, such as increased quality and efficiency and lower development costs and effort, as well as shorter commercialization times. This research aims to study and understand the state of the practice of software reuse in Colombia, to make comparisons with related works, and to offer an instrument for decision-making in companies that adopt these practices. To reach these objectives, three stages were proposed. In the first stage, the research questions were defined. In the second stage, a survey was developed, evaluated, and carried out to validate successful practices and adoption barriers in the context of the Colombian software industry. Finally, the results were analyzed and reported. This paper showed and evidenced the expectations, adoption barriers, and factors influencing the success of software reuse in Colombian industrial environments. In the same way, the experience from the development of this work serves as a roadmap for other regions that want to analyze the current state of reuse.     BPMNt : a proposal for flexible process tailoring representation in BPMN /

    Business Process Model and Notation (BPMN) is a de-facto standard for business process modeling, which focuses on the representation of the process behavior. However, it can also succeed in representing the behavior of software processes, since they are a type of business process. Although BPMN has been extensively used for modeling processes in different domains, its standard specification does not have any mechanism to support users in activities related to process adaptation (tailoring). Moreover, researches extending BPMN are based on complex consolidated models, which hamper the analysis and maintenance of individual variant process models and are not appropriate for application domains in which process variations are difficult to predict, such as in software development processes. Thus, our objective was to provide a BPMN-compliant extension and associated mechanisms for specifying flexible process tailoring on models produced with this language while ensuring the correctness of adapted process models and explicitly capturing change traces. We have focused our research on the domains of Software Process Engineering (SPE) and Business Process Management (BPM).
